How to Authenticate High End Resilient Flooring (HERF)?

Just like buying leather products, they are genuine ones and they are the non-genuine ones. Likewise for flooring, it is very important to look into what you are buying as it will be something that is permanent in the home. 

To authenticate genuine quality high end resilient floor (HERF) products from the non-genuine ones, home owners may need to look into these following details.

Health Standard

Air quality is something that is unseen with the naked eye but it is also highly important especially when most of us stayed in indoor enclosed areas. Ask the supplier for these following documents and reports such as whether the floorboard has passed any form of Volatile Organic Compound test, SVHC (Substance of Very High Concern) test as well as whether the flooring product has at least an E1 rating based on european standard for Formaldehyde emission. Detect for any Smell

Good quality and genuine high end resilient flooring (HERF) products are usually odourless when you hold a sample of the floorboard close to your nose literally. On the other hand for lower quality or non-genuine high end resilient flooring, it will comes with a 'soapy' or 'plasticky' smell. This is probably due to the composite balance of the flooring material during production. Such smell will be obvious when the flooring is installed in enclosed areas (window closed) for a period of days; for example when the home owners are away for holidays. 

Coating May Be Different

Ask about the coating layer for the flooring. Genuine quality high end resilient flooring (HERF) has a layer of ceramic beaded coating to enhance its scratch and impact resistance.
